It aired on October 3, 2021. Tensions rise between The 50 Boyz and their rivals, which creates repercussions. Lamar plants misinformation so he can actively step towards the throne. Meech races to Downriver Memorial Hospital, armed with a submachine gun, after learning that Terry was shot. Detective Lopez ...The King of Detroit is the eighth and final episode of the first season of the Starz original crime drama BMF. It aired on November 21, 2021. In an effort to expand into new territory, Meech discovers a disturbing alliance then hatches a plan to eliminate the threat. Terry is forced to make a life-altering decision. The captivating tales of the Flenory brothers ...Catherine "Kato" Eda was She was Born August 6th 1967 A fierce and ambitious corner girl, Kato was the only women in Meech and Terry's crew. Both a brilliant and troubled young woman, the Flenory brothers were the first to treat Kato like family. In this clip, Ladon ‘Beast’ Simon talked about how he was introduced to the drug game. He said that he initially began his foray into the streets around 14-years-old. Ladon also recounted how he learned about his dad being in the streets.

Title: The Untold Story of Lamar from BMF: A Real-Life Journey of Triumph and Tragedy Introduction: In the world of...Lamar Silas. Lamar was born December 14th 1961. Lamar is a cross between a serial killer and a court jester. An erratic street legend whose unbelievable stories of conquest were part of hood lore. Lamar returned to Southwest Detroit to reclaim his territory and his lady.Sep 8, 2023 · Layton Simon, a former American drug dealer, serves as the real-life inspiration behind the character Lamar Silas in the American TV series BMF.
